
Organized by the Frankfurt School Blockchain Center, the seventh Crypto Assets Conference (CAC) will take place from October 18 to October 19, 2022.
The world of digital assets is changing rapidly. C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um mature, DeFi protocols and NFTs grow at a rapid pace, Metaverse is the tech’s newest trend, the Digital Euro is being discussed frequently, and blockchain technology has more use cases than ever. Digital assets are here to stay, and their future is brighter than ever before.
At one of Europe’s leading digital assets conferences, a diverse range of thought leaders and industry experts, e.g., from BitMEX, Coinbase, the European Parliament, Frankfurt School Blockchain Center, Hauck Aufhäuser Lampe, PwC, sustainliquid, Börse Stuttgart, KPMG, BNY Mellon, BNP Paribas, EY, and many more will unite to talk about all things crypto.
